Easy SkyMesh uses LoRa as the long range (2–15 km) wireless technology and Meshtastic router / repeaters to further extend the wireless range for IoT devices.
To further expand the network coverage, we use Meshtastic routers / repeaters:
- To extend communication range: If Node A is 12 km from Node B, and they can’t reach each other directly, a router / repeater placed in between can bridge that gap.
- To improve network reliability: If one path fails (e.g., a node goes offline), a router / repeater provides an alternate route.
- To support battery devices: Battery devices can go to deepsleep to save power. Repeaters do the heavy lifting — they are usually solar- or mains-powered and always on.

Usecases
It is recommended to use a repeater if:
- Devices are more than 3–5 km apart in complex terrain.
- You want to relay messages across hills, valleys, or buildings.
- You want to make a battery-powered sensor/handheld more efficient.
- You are building an emergency backup or off-grid system.
